If you are planning on selling your house in the near future and don’t like what your home is currently appraising at, maybe it’s time to make changes before you list. While you are deciding on what changes you need to make, keep two things in mind:

  • Choose projects that enhance the look of your house.
  • Choose projects that will add value to your house.

Believe it or not, most window changes can do both of those.

Windows to Enhance Look

Your windows are a big part of your home. They make up both part of the structure and extremely affect the overall look of the home. With no windows, your home looks like a big, wood box. With old windows, you home looks old.With new windows, you have an updated house that looks like it is well taken care of. Houses that look taken care of and are up-to-date sell much better than ones that are not. It’s all about the look if you want to sell at the price you want.You can also use windows to change the structure of your home by putting in windows to replace large sections of wall. More windows make a house feel more open and spacious, and at the moment that is what potential buyers are looking for. They are looking for reasonably priced homes that feel large.

Windows to Add Value

New windows, especially energy-efficient ones, add value to a home in a number of different ways:

  • The windows are brand new, so they are the most up-to-date models.
  • They will not have to be replaced for another 5 to 10 years, saving the buyers money.
  • The new, energy-efficient windows will save on the power bill as compared to the old windows, also saving the buyers money.

Be Creative with Windows

Another way to both add value and enhance the look of your home with windows is by turning your unused patio into an enclosed patio. An enclosed patio makes that area of your home look better, and it also adds square footage and another room to your home.
